    That corn flour looked a lot like corn starch. I have seen many Asian recipes call for corn starch in the early stages of preparing a dish, but never corn flour. Can anyone clarify if it is actual flour, or if it's actually corn starch?

    • @davidf.8345
      @davidf.8345 2 ปีที่แล้ว +3

      Cornflour (1 word) is same as corn starch. Corn Flour (2 words) is like corn meal that has been further ground down so it has a AP wheat flour feel to it. Not sure about the rest of the world, but these are the US “definitions “

    • @spicenpans
      @spicenpans  2 ปีที่แล้ว +2

      Hi David, i just realised that cornflour and cornstarch are different in the United States. In Singapore, we only get one type which we call it cornflour or cornstarch interchangeably. Maybe it'll be easier to let you know how our cornflour aka cornstarch looks like - it's whitish in colour. Hope this helps.
